So do you do this...we have done it for 15 years with our boys. Even though they no longer believe we still track him and it is fun...here is the link....the countdown has started already....:santa:

http://www.noradsanta.org/en/home.html at the bottom of the NORAD page there is a link to DL Google Earth..it is free and safe...you will need to do a 2 second DL to track Santa in 3D....

it is a great way to get the kids off to bed on time...we would show them that he is soon to be in Ca. and they have to go to bed...it always worked. And they would get so excited. You can track him and they will also show you a video of each country and state they travel through in addition to a map that has red dots of where he was already. By the time they are heading to Ca. there are red Dots all over hte map. You can also click on the dots and they will play a video of Santa going through that area...here is a you tube of last years..part of it anyway...
